Highlights
Are people in Herndon older or younger than people in Dover?
- The Median Age in Herndon is 1.3 years older than in Dover.

Are housing costs cheaper in Herndon or Dover?
- Herndon housing costs are 130.6% more expensive than Dover hous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Herndon or Dover?
- The average commute for residents of Herndon is 5.5 minutes longer than it is for residents of Dover.

 Dover, DEHerndon, VAUnited States
 Population38,94024,574329,725,481
 Median Income$51,073$117,741$69,021
 Median Age34.435.738.4
 Avg. Home Price$279,600$644,800$338,100
 Unemployment Rate10.3%4.6%6.0%
 Avg. Commute Time21.5927.0526.38
